Regulatory Evolution: From Licensing to Responsible Gambling Initiatives
Since the implementation of the Remote Gambling Licence by the UK Gambling Commission (UKGC), industry standards have advanced considerably. The UKGC’s stringent requirements, including thorough due diligence and ongoing compliance assessments, have established the nation as a global leader in gambling regulation. These measures aim to ensure fair play, prevent underage gambling, and combat money laundering.
In recent years, regulatory focus has expanded to encompass responsible gambling initiatives. Organizations now employ advanced data analytics and behavioral tracking to identify vulnerable players proactively. For instance, some platforms incorporate responsible gambling tools such as deposit limits, self-exclusion options, and real-time risk assessments—features that are increasingly becoming industry standards rather than exceptions.
Technological Innovation and Player Experience
Next-generation technology—such as blockchain, artificial intelligence, and mobile-first platforms—has revolutionized user engagement and security measures. Blockchain, in particular, introduces transparency and auditability, fostering greater trust among players. Real-time data analysis enhances the personalization of gaming experiences, while rigorous cybersecurity protocols safeguard sensitive information.
An illustrative example is the integration of cryptographic proof systems that verify game fairness without exposing proprietary algorithms. These innovations not only improve transparency but also set a new benchmark for industry credibility.

Impact of Emerging Legislation and Self-Regulation
Emerging legislative proposals in the UK aim to refine existing frameworks—addressing issues like advertising restrictions, credit betting, and age verification processes. Simultaneously, industry-led self-regulation initiatives emphasize ethical marketing and player safeguarding. Notably, partnerships between regulators and operators have fostered a collaborative environment, accelerating the adoption of Responsible Gambling standards.
